Understanding Tennis Betting Odds

For those interested in betting, understanding how odds work is crucial. Odds represent the likelihood of a particular outcome and can impact potential returns. Below is a brief overview:

Types of Odds:

  • American Odds: Positive numbers indicate how much you would win on a $100 bet. Negative numbers show how much you need to bet to win $100.
  • Fractional Odds: Common in the UK, represented as fractions (e.g., 5/1). The numerator is your profit for every unit of the denominator you bet.
  • Decimal Odds: Common globally, including Europe and Australia. Involves multiplying your total stake by the decimal odds to calculate potential returns.
